Texas Instruments Embedded Processing — Gross Profit remained flat by 0.0% to $306.50M in Q4 2025 compared to the prior quarter. Year-over-year, this metric grew by 0.7%, from $304.50M to $306.50M. Over 3 years (FY 2022 to FY 2025), Embedded Processing — Gross Profit shows a downward trend with a -15.6% CAGR. This decline may warrant attention — for this metric, higher values are generally preferred.
